Я использую Carrierwave и Imagemagick. Иногда у меня есть изображения с портретными размерами. В моем файле загрузчика у меня установлены изображения resize_to_fill
.
process resize_to_fill: [600, 600]
Создает изображение в соответствии с моими спецификациями, но, как и ожидалось, сохраняет соотношение сторон, заполняя оставшееся пространство цветом. Есть ли способ полностью заполнить вновь созданное изображение исходным изображением и отцентрировать его так же, как в CSS3 object-fit: cover ?